School Overview
Bonita Springs Middle Center for the Arts, located in Bonita Springs, Florida, is a specialized magnet school within the School District of Lee County. The school distinguishes itself by integrating a rigorous academic curriculum with an intensive focus on the performing and visual arts. Students have the opportunity to engage in a variety of artistic disciplines—including dance, music, theater, and visual arts—alongside their core subjects, fostering an environment where creative expression is used as a tool to enhance critical thinking and student engagement.
Beyond its focus on the arts, the school is deeply committed to preparing its middle school population for future success through a holistic approach to education. By providing a platform for students to explore their talents through specialized electives and public performances, Bonita Springs Middle Center for the Arts cultivates a vibrant campus culture that emphasizes self-discipline, collaboration, and community involvement. The school serves as a focal point for local culture in Bonita Springs, aiming to provide a well-rounded middle school experience that nurtures both the academic and artistic potential of every student.

Student Demographics
Student Demographics Data Table
| Demographic | Student Count |
|---|---|
| White | 176 |
| Hispanic | 602 |
| Black | 8 |
| Asian | 7 |
| Two or More | 14 |
